Output 7d9bd604628f9c59512c97949a0d199c8b69c91b58b5ed4391f61a73fc7d183c:91

value
17754076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b0e77e178cdf424e6c2d032cbbce71a386d18ef OP_EQUAL
address
3FpszYwRUQXQAMGPpKqZyrZsfSMBPobN41
transaction
7d9bd604628f9c59512c97949a0d199c8b69c91b58b5ed4391f61a73fc7d183c
spent
true